Solar Wolf Energy Expands Footprint in Massachusetts


MILLBURY, Mass., Dec. 18, 2018 /PRNewswire/ -- With the recent addition of a 20,000-plus square foot building to its list of locations, Solar Wolf Energy has just become the largest solar company in all of New England.

Starting January 1, 2019, Solar Wolf Energy will begin work on a large space at 100 Davis Street in Douglas, Massachusetts. The state-of-the-art facility, which will house Solar Wolf's main operations, will be employee-focused, with a full gym with showers, meditation room, library and other aspects to maintain and improve staff morale and focus. In addition to those and the implicit office space, the building also features a large warehouse space and garage for its array of equipment and fleet of vehicles.

"In our quest to help New Englanders save money and decrease their carbon footprint, we've grown so much that we have to expand our physical footprint!" said Solar Wolf Energy Chairman and CEO Ted Strzelecki. "It's essential that we have a contemporary, yet welcoming 'den' for our Wolf Pack?employees and customers alike."

The Douglas location will be Solar Wolf Energy's third building in Massachusetts, along with sites in Millbury and Marlborough. Renovations are expected to conclude before the second quarter of 2019.
